仿tokenpocket搭建

仿tokenpocket搭建

一剑开天门 2025-01-01 NFT 9 次浏览 0个评论

# 如何搭建一个类似于TokenPocket的加密钱包:详细指南

在数字货币逐渐渗透日常生活的今天,越来越多的用户开始关注加密钱包的使用与安全性。TokenPocket作为目前最受欢迎的加密钱包之一,其便捷、安全、多链支持的特点使得它在全球范围内拥有了大量用户。如果你也想搭建一个类似于TokenPocket的加密钱包,本文将为你提供一份详细的搭建指南,帮助你快速理解如何构建一个多功能、安全性强的加密钱包,满足用户的需求。

搭建加密钱包需要一定的技术背景,尤其是涉及到区块链技术和钱包的安全设计。本篇文章将从多个维度,逐步解析如何构建一个类似于TokenPocket的加密钱包,涵盖技术架构、功能设计、安全防护、用户体验等方面的内容,帮助你打造一个功能全面的数字资产管理工具。

---

1. 了解TokenPocket钱包的基本功能

要搭建一个与TokenPocket类似的加密钱包,首先需要了解它的基本功能和特色。TokenPocket作为一个去中心化的多链钱包,它支持包括比特币(BTC)、以太坊(ETH)、EOS、TRON等在内的多个主流区块链。它还具备强大的DApp浏览器功能,方便用户访问去中心化应用(DApp)进行交易和互动。

**多链支持**

TokenPocket的最大特色之一是它的多链支持能力,这使得用户可以在一个钱包内管理多个不同区块链的资产。每条链的资产独立管理,钱包能够实时显示各个链的余额、交易记录,并支持相应的转账功能。

**DApp集成**

除了传统的加密货币管理功能,TokenPocket还将DApp浏览器集成在钱包内,允许用户直接通过钱包与区块链应用进行交互。用户无需切换不同的应用和钱包,便可以轻松访问去中心化金融(DeFi)、NFT、游戏等多个领域的应用。

**安全性保障**

TokenPocket采用了多重安全措施来保护用户的资产安全。例如,它支持私钥本地存储,绝对避免用户的私钥泄露。它还提供了多重身份验证和加密技术,以保证交易和资产管理的安全。

---

2. 设计一个符合用户需求的钱包界面

一个钱包的用户体验非常重要。简洁、易用、直观的界面设计能够帮助用户快速上手,提高钱包的使用频率。在搭建一个类似于TokenPocket的钱包时,必须注重界面设计与用户体验的结合。

**清晰的资产展示**

钱包的主界面应当清晰展示所有链的资产,用户可以快速查看每个区块链的余额及相关信息。可以为每个资产链设置独立的图标或颜色,帮助用户区分不同的数字货币。

**简洁的转账流程**

钱包的转账功能必须设计得非常简单。用户只需要输入收款地址、选择转账金额并确认交易即可。在这个过程中,减少多余的步骤和信息展示,确保用户能够快速完成转账操作。

**DApp入口的设计**

为了提高用户与DApp互动的便捷性,可以设计一个统一的DApp入口,将各类DApp按照分类展示。用户能够根据自己的需求,快速找到并访问不同的去中心化应用,提升钱包的综合使用体验。

---

3. 实现多链资产管理与跨链操作

要搭建一个类似于TokenPocket的钱包,如何管理多链资产是一个重要课题。不同区块链之间有着不同的协议和技术要求,需要实现多链资产的统一管理和跨链操作。

**多链资产支持的实现**

你需要集成不同区块链的SDK,以支持BTC、ETH、TRON、EOS等主流链。每种区块链的SDK通常都提供了基本的API接口,可以帮助你实现资产的查询、转账等功能。

**跨链操作的设计**

跨链操作可以通过跨链协议来实现。例如,可以集成一些现有的跨链协议(如Cosmos、Polkadot等)来实现不同链之间的资产转移。跨链的实现需要较高的技术难度和安全性保障,因此在设计时要特别注意安全性和效率。

**资产的自动切换与管理**

为了方便用户,钱包应当能够根据用户的需求自动切换到不同链的资产管理界面。通过用户设置或智能识别,钱包可以自动显示当前用户关注的资产链,并提供跨链转账等高级功能。

---

4. 强化钱包的安全性设计

安全性是数字货币钱包最为重要的功能之一,尤其是像TokenPocket这样的多链钱包,它需要承担更高的安全风险。为此,安全设计的每个环节都不能忽视。

**私钥管理**

TokenPocket采用本地存储私钥的方式,这意味着私钥不会上传到云端,最大程度地避免了黑客攻击的风险。你在搭建钱包时,必须确保私钥的加密存储,并考虑加密算法的强度和私钥备份的方式。

**多重身份验证**

为了增强钱包的安全性,可以集成多重身份验证机制,如指纹识别、面部识别、密码和动态验证码等。在进行转账或操作时,钱包应该要求用户进行多重验证,以降低黑客通过恶意手段获取资金的可能性。

**交易安全保障**

交易的安全性也是设计的重点。可以采用区块链上的智能合约技术,确保每一笔交易在执行前得到验证,并且能够防止恶意交易的发生。钱包应当提供交易签名功能,只有用户确认签名后,交易才能生效。

---

5. 提升用户体验的个性化设置

用户在使用钱包时,除了功能需求外,个性化的设置也是提高用户粘性的一个重要因素。TokenPocket通过多种个性化设置来满足用户不同的需求。

**主题与皮肤的自定义**

钱包可以设计多种不同的主题和皮肤,让用户能够根据自己的喜好定制界面的颜色和布局。不同的主题风格可以满足不同用户的审美需求,使得钱包的使用体验更加愉悦。

**通知和提醒设置**

在进行资金转账或资产变动时,钱包应当提供及时的提醒功能。用户可以自定义提醒的内容,如余额不足、转账成功、交易失败等。这种个性化的提醒功能能够帮助用户及时了解资产的变化,并作出反应。

**简化的操作设置**

用户界面的简化也是提升体验的重要因素。你可以为不同的用户群体(例如新手用户、老手用户)设计不同的操作流程。对于新手用户,可以提供引导功能,帮助他们逐步了解钱包的基本功能;而对于老手用户,可以提供快捷操作,减少不必要的步骤。

仿tokenpocket搭建

---

6. 搭建钱包背后的区块链技术架构

要实现一个稳定、安全的加密钱包,必须有一个坚实的技术架构支撑。区块链技术架构的选择将直接影响钱包的性能、安全性以及扩展性。

**区块链节点与API接口**

钱包需要连接到各个区块链节点,获取区块链的实时数据。你可以选择搭建自己的区块链节点,或者通过第三方服务提供商提供的API接口来访问链上的数据。这部分的设计需要特别注意节点的稳定性和API的响应速度。

**智能合约与交易签名**

智能合约技术是区块链技术的一大亮点。在搭建钱包时,可以利用智能合约来处理钱包中的交易逻辑,例如自动执行转账操作、保障交易的安全性等。钱包中的交易签名功能也是不可忽视的一部分,确保交易只会在用户授权的情况下执行。

**可扩展性与升级机制**

随着区块链技术的发展和用户需求的变化,钱包需要具备可扩展性。例如,可以设计模块化的架构,方便以后根据需求增加新的区块链支持,或集成新的去中心化应用。升级机制也同样重要,确保钱包能够在不影响用户使用的情况下,进行功能的优化和安全的更新。

---

7. 维护与持续优化:如何提升钱包的长期竞争力

一个成功的加密钱包不仅仅在发布时功能完备,更需要在后续的维护和优化中持续提升用户体验和市场竞争力。

仿tokenpocket搭建

**定期的安全更新与漏洞修复**

随着区块链技术和网络环境的不断变化,钱包可能会遭遇新的安全威胁。钱包的开发者需要定期对安全性进行检测,发布安全补丁和更新,确保用户的资产始终处于安全状态。

**用户反馈的收集与迭代**

用户的反馈是产品优化的核心。通过收集用户的使用体验和

转载请注明来自TP官方正版下载_2025tp钱包官网地址_正规安全tp下载,本文标题:《仿tokenpocket搭建》

每一天,每一秒,你所做的决定都会改变你的人生!

发表评论

快捷回复:

评论列表 (暂无评论,9人围观)参与讨论

还没有评论,来说两句吧...